    Thank you for the wonderful lesson! I'm having difficulties clarifying something about open compound nouns (noun+noun). For instance, compound nouns such as "car park", "dream theater", "requirement specifications" - they all infer a plural meaning, don't they? I mean, a car park is a park where there are a lot of cars there, not just one single car (but you wouldn't say "cars park" or "cars parks"). The same should apply to "requirement specification", right? One wouldn't say "requirements specification" or "requirements specifications", even though the noun "requirement specifications" refers to "the specifications of the requirements". Or did I get it all wrong? I hope I'll get a answer from you. I wish you all the best.

    • @ShawEnglishOnline
      @ShawEnglishOnline  4 года назад

      A car park only means 1 facility.
      You still need to add an 's' to make it plural.
      Requirement specification is just 1.
